registerScriptMessageHandlerWithReply

Registers a new user script message handler in script world with name @world_name.

Different from webkit_user_content_manager_register_script_message_handler(), when using this function to register the handler, the connected signal is script-message-with-reply-received, and a reply provided by the user is expected. Otherwise, the user will receive a default undefined value.

If null is passed as the @world_name, the default world will be used. See webkit_user_content_manager_register_script_message_handler() for full description.

Registering a script message handler will fail if the requested name has been already registered before.

The registered handler can be unregistered by using webkit_user_content_manager_unregister_script_message_handler().

Return

true if message handler was registered successfully, or false otherwise.

Since

2.40

Parameters

name

Name of the script message channel

worldName

the name of a #WebKitScriptWorld
